Cognitive Stimulation Course
This course equips care professionals with skills to implement cognitive stimulation therapy (CST) in residential settings, focusing on designing, delivering, and evaluating group sessions to enhance cognitive function and well-being for residents with dementia or mild cognitive impairment.

What will I learn?
The Cognitive Stimulation Course provides practical tools to plan and deliver effective small-group sessions in residential care. Learn evidence-based principles, session structuring, adaptive techniques for sensory or cognitive limitations, and simple mood, behaviour, and engagement tracking. Build clear 4-week programmes, interpret outcomes, and communicate concise, actionable feedback to multidisciplinary care teams.

Develop skills
- Design brief cognitive programmes: plan 4-week, twice-weekly CST in care homes.
- Lead engaging sessions: adapt tasks to cognitive level, sensory limits, and mood.
- Track outcomes fast: use simple sheets to rate attendance, engagement, and affect.
- Apply person-centred care: align cognitive tasks with identity, culture, and goals.
- Communicate results clearly: summarise trends and recommendations for care teams.
